You should regularly check for water damage to your bathroom floor caused by your toilet in order to save money and further complications. Feel the floor around the toilet and check to see if the floor is soft, molded, chipping, etc. You can check for softness or weakness in the floor by placing one foot on each side of the toilet and rocking back and forth. Identify any damage and repair it before it gets worse. In the long run, you are likely to save money by not putting off the repair.

Use baking soda and one cup of vinegar per month to keep the bathtub drain clear and running well. This will cause a chemical reaction to occur and you should plug the drain. Wait for a bit, then flush with boiling water. This method should clear your pipes of accumulated hair and soap scum.

Don’t treat your toilet like a garbage can if you want to avoid a lot of potential plumbing problems. Do not flush things like paper towels, sanitary pads, tissues, diapers, cotton balls or anything else that might cause the toilet to get clogged. In addition, you should only use the amount of toilet paper that is absolutely necessary when cleaning yourself.

Be certain that your toilet does not leak. A good tip for this is to take food coloring and put a few drops in your toilet tank. If colored water appears in your bowl soon after you put food coloring in the tank, your toilet is leaking. Fix leaks as soon as possible after you discover them.

A water heater that has no tank is a good choice for those that are conservation-minded. Whereas a conventional water heater stores hot water, a tankless water heater will heat the water only as needed. This will save you a significant amount of money that would have been wasted heating up water that you aren’t using.
